Frederick Morris

ProfilePosted byOptionsPost Date

Ryan

Ryan Report 3 Mar 2008 20:21

Hi everyone. I am trying to find information on the children of Frederick Morris (1878 Bradford-On-Avon) and Elsie Ewence. If anyone could provide information on Elsie Ewence's birth and death that would be great.

Marriage records:-
Bradford-on Avon - June Quarter 1918
Elsie A Ewence marriage to Frederick J Morris

Ewence not a common name, only 53 on 1901 census so the probability is that Elsie is shown in this census as Eliza Anne Ewence, a visitor at 1 New Road, Bradford-on-Avon. Only other occupant is Amelia Fisher aged 77. Eliza (or Elsie) is shown as 8 years old.

Birth registered as Elsie Annie Ewence, January Quarter of 1893 (Bradford, Wiltshire)
